3. 📉 2025 Tax Changes That Impact Indiana Paychecks
Tax rates are subject to change every year. In 2025, Indiana has made slight adjustments to state income tax rates, as well as updates to withholding tables.
Key Updates in 2025:
- Indiana State Income Tax Rate: Lowered slightly from 3.15% to 3.05%
- Standard Deduction (Federal): Increased for inflation
- Social Security Wage Base: Increased to $172,200
- Medicare Threshold: 0.9% surtax still applies to incomes above $200,000 (individual)
These changes affect how much is withheld from your paycheck, making it even more essential to use a current-year calculator.
4. 💰 Key Components of an Indiana Paycheck
Here’s a breakdown of what’s typically deducted from your paycheck:
Component | Percentage (Approx.) | Notes |
---|---|---|
Federal Income Tax | Varies (10%-37%) | Based on filing status and income |
State Income Tax | 3.05% | Flat for all Indiana residents |
Social Security | 6.2% | Up to wage base limit |
Medicare | 1.45% | Additional 0.9% for high earners |
Local Taxes | 1%-3.5% | Based on county of residence or work |
Pre-Tax Deductions | Varies | 401(k), HSA, insurance premiums, etc. |

6. 🧾 Indiana State Taxes in Detail
Indiana uses a flat state income tax rate, which applies uniformly regardless of your income level.
- 2025 Rate: 3.05%
- Indiana doesn’t have separate tax brackets like the federal system.
- Local income taxes vary by county, ranging from 1% to 3.5%.
Popular counties like Marion, Lake, Allen, and Hamilton have slightly higher local tax rates.

8. 📍 Special Considerations for Indiana Residents
Indiana has several unique rules that can affect your paycheck:
- County Tax Withholding: Based on where you live on January 1st each year
- Reciprocal Tax Agreements: Not applicable – Indiana taxes all residents and non-residents who work in the state
- Unemployment Tax: Employers pay, but it doesn’t affect net paycheck

11. ❓ FAQs About Indiana Paycheck Calculation
Q1. Is Indiana a high-tax state for income?
No, Indiana has one of the lowest flat income tax rates at 3.05% in 2025.
Q2. Does Indiana have local income taxes?
Yes. Counties levy local income taxes from 1% to 3.5%, depending on location.
Q3. Are bonuses taxed differently in Indiana?
Yes, bonuses are usually taxed at a flat federal supplemental rate of 22%, plus applicable state and local taxes.
Q4. How do I calculate overtime pay in Indiana?
Overtime is 1.5x your regular hourly rate for hours worked over 40 in a week. Use the calculator’s overtime option to include it.
Q5. Does Indiana tax Social Security benefits?
No, Indiana does not tax Social Security benefits for retirees.
